The CNC Machining Operator/Programmer duties will include:
- Performs daily machine startup and shutdown procedures on machining equipment.
- Review shop drawings to create and modify programs when necessary. Ensuring that changes are well documented and sent back to Engineering for review and update.
- Verify correct materials are being machined by cross referencing against the work order and BOM.
- Able to program machine based on job requirements.
- Loads and unloads components into the machine.
- Secures parts to machining center using provided clamps, jigs, or other fixtures as required.
- Able to adjust machining center speed in order to maximize production while manufacturing quality products.
- Performs first off inspections to ensure components meet the drawing specifications.
- Capable of checking components with basic inspection equipment (calipers, micrometers, depth gauge, etc).
- Performs minor maintenance and cleaning of cutting equipment and work area in accordance with company standards and manufactures machine recommendations.
- Able to quickly adapt to changing production requirements.
- Communicates effectively with Supervisor, Lead Hand, and other company staff members.
- Obeys all established safety practices.
- Identifies safety hazards and reports to Supervisor immediately.
- Wears all personal protective equipment as instructed by the company.
- Other duties as assigned by Supervisor.
